How does a cylinder work

There is a key passage in the rotor, a key moves along it, which changes the position of the pins. These elements line up in a secret combination that matches the pattern on the key. Ultimately, the pins under the influence of the native key are installed in one line. The new position of these elements allows the rotor and cam to turn. When the key is removed from the key hole, the locking pins, under the influence of springs, push the codes back into the rotor element, blocking occurs.

When someone else's key is taken, the code pattern of which does not match the secret combination of the cylinder, the pins cannot line up in the correct position, some will remain in the body, others in the rotor. The rotor will not rotate in this case. The more complex the combination, the more precisely all the elements fit, the more difficult it is to open the cylinder with a non-native key.

Vulnerabilities in cylinders

If it is practically impossible to open the cylinder lock with a non-native key, then such devices are not sufficiently protected from the action of vandals, they can be drilled or knocked out. Protective elements help to resist, these are armor plates made of especially strong alloys. In order for this part to actually protect the larva from vandalism, it must be placed correctly. It is installed inside the door leaf, and not on top of metal or decorative trim. Armor plates must be installed on all cylinder locks, and especially where there is a high probability of breaking them by force.

What to do if the key is stolen or lost

Although the cylinder lock cylinder is easy to change if the keys are lost, you should not do this right away. Many modern devices have the function of self-transcoding. What does it mean? The larva is sold complete with a master key. If the keys are lost, it is necessary to insert the master key and turn it, recoding will occur, and it will be impossible to open the lock with the old keys. And you will need to make new duplicates from the master key. In the case when the lock does not have a recoding function, it can be easily ordered at a service workshop by presenting the original key.

Lever lock mechanism

The level lock is considered one of the most reliable among all locking devices for the entrance plastic, metal or wooden door. Its secret lies in a group of plates or levers, which have cutouts of various shapes. Each of them corresponds to the protrusions and depressions on the key, which allow you to assemble the plates in the right way, and open the lock.

The reliability of a lever lock depends on the number of levers. Each individual option for placing lever plates of different contours is called a series. By increasing the number of levers with different arrangements of protrusions and depressions, you can increase the number of series. For a lock with three plates, it is 6. For four-lever locks, the set of plates gives 24 different series, respectively. In locks that have two rows of levers, the number of series reaches 150. Double-bit keys are used to open them.

The principle of operation of a lever lock is similar to a cylindrical one, only the role of pins in it is performed by steel plates. To increase protection, so that it is more difficult to assemble the plates and make it difficult to open the lock with a random key, lever cutouts are made in various sizes, and the plates themselves are of different thicknesses.

Leverless lock

The structure of a leverless lock is characterized by only one plate, so this lock is considered the most unreliable. Therefore, experts recommend installing it on internal doors.

The secrecy of leverless locking devices is given by the configuration of the shape of the key slot. In addition, on the base of the lock, opposite the key gap, there are barrier plates or annular ledges. They are made in the form of concentric circles, to bypass which special slots are made along and across the grooves of the keys.

Popular door lock models

By resistance to burglary, this type of locks for entrance doors is classified into 4 classes, depending on how long it takes to open it:

  • first class - less than 5 minutes (suitable for installation in interior doors, rooms without material values);
  • the second - more than 5 minutes (suitable for installation on apartment entrance doors, protective properties - medium);
  • the third - 15 minutes (suitable for locking rooms with valuables inside, the protective properties are increased);
  • the fourth - 30 minutes (suitable for locking the doors of rooms in which there are valuables of great value, the protective properties are high).

An example of a certificate of conformity for a mortise lock with an indication of the security class

In addition to resistance to opening, the mechanism is tested for secrecy, reliability and strength. Based on all these indicators, the lock is assigned a final security class.

    The crossbar (rack) lock is a simple device, inside of which there is a crossbar (rail) with teeth and machined grooves. The kit comes with a long key with grooves that match when inserted into the keyhole.

    Unlike other types of locks, where unlocking occurs by turning, the crossbar is opened by pressing the key into the keyhole. In this case, a spring is compressed inside the device and the locking rail is shifted to the side.

    The bolt mechanism belongs to the first class of safety, that is, it has low protective properties. There is an opinion that this lock can be opened with a pencil, so it should not be used to lock rooms that contain something valuable.

    Scope of application: gates, gates, access doors, utility rooms, any premises in which there are no especially valuable things.

    Disc locking devices were developed by the Finnish company Abloy, so they are often called Finnish, or abloy, regardless of who the manufacturer is.

    Inside the case, in a special cylinder, there are disks with free rotation relative to each other. Each disk has a hole into which the key is inserted, as well as a groove for a special balance rod. When inserting the "native" key into the well, the disks rotate and the grooves of each line up in one row, forming a place for the balance rod to enter. The cylinder with disks rotates and the bolt opens.

    If there is an attempt to open the mechanism with another key, the disks do not turn, the "groove" for the rod is not formed. The rod turns out to be clamped between the disks and the cylinder wall, the cylinder does not turn, the opening does not occur.

    The more disks in the cylinder, the more reliable the device. Disc mechanisms of class 1-2 are often used in interior doors, with more a high degree reliability - in other rooms, but as a rule they are an additional protection device.

    Electromechanical locks in their internal structure do not differ much from traditional mechanical ones. The main difference is the possibility of remote opening and closing. By installation, they are mortise and overhead. Mortise are considered more reliable, as they are more protected from third-party access to the mechanism.

    Electromechanical locks are classified according to the type of drive: solenoid and motor.

    • In places of heavy traffic of people, as a rule, a lock with a solenoid type of drive is installed, since its standard position is open, and when an electric signal is applied, it closes.
    • With a motor type of drive, the lock is closed in the standard position; when voltage is applied, it opens. Such devices must not be installed on doors located in the way of emergency evacuation of people.

    Lock with handle

    The simplest and most common option is a lock with a handle. It can be either a simple latch without a lock, or a more complex mechanism that involves the use of a key. How to deal with such fittings?

    First of all, you need to take care of removing the handle itself. To do this, unscrew the screw from the side or bottom using a screwdriver or a hex wrench. For nobs, a special key is used to lock the spring-loaded pin. Then remove the decorative trim and unscrew the fixing screws. Remove the handle together with the axial part. This will give you access to the lock mechanism.

    Scheme of the device of an interior lock with a handle

    In order to disassemble the lock itself, you must first unscrew the plate from the end part. it can be held by 2-4 screws. After that, removing the tongue with all the other details is not difficult. You just need to push them in and get through the hole in the door leaf at the place where the handle was installed.

    For a latch lock, there is a slightly different, but nevertheless largely similar principle of operation. In order to disassemble such a mechanism, you will need to initially remove the part that is located on the front side of the door.

    To do this, unscrew the decorative cap from the side of the plug, it is often attached to the thread, but there are models that are fixed on the latch. After that, unscrew the screws that have opened to you and carefully remove the mechanism, including from the reverse side.

    Scheme of the interior latch device

    To remove the lock, unscrew the end plate and gently push the inside of it. If the latch is connected to the handle, you will need to completely disassemble both to get the part you are interested in.

    If you plan to completely replace the lock, do not forget to unscrew the strike plate on the door frame.

    Castle and its device

    The main element of the mechanism is an electromagnet, which is a core made of transformer steel in the shape of the letter Sh. Such steel does not have a memory effect and is a magnetically soft material. The core is recruited from a large number of thin plates or made from a single plate.

    Around the core is a winding of copper wire coated with enamel. The coil has a large number (up to a thousand or more) turns. When an electric current passes through the winding, an electromagnetic field is created in the core, which controls the operation of the lock.

    However, over time, there is a weakening of the mechanical characteristics of the door due to the effect of residual magnetization. To combat it, the effect of changing the polarity of the voltage is used when the locking device is demagnetized. However, in this case, force is required to open the door.

    Due to the absence of moving parts, the lock has a long service life.

    Since low-alloy steel is used for the manufacture of lock parts, which is easily corroded, they must be protected. For protection, varnishing, galvanizing or nickel plating is used.

    The main parameter of the lock is the force of holding the door. To increase the force that is applied to hold the door, it is possible to install several locks. This value depends on the material from which the core and armature are made, the current strength and the number of turns in the coil winding. Performed overhead type.

    Types of electromagnetic locks

    Depending on the work of the anchor, the structures are divided into holding and shear. In holding models, the anchor acts on separation, and in shear models, it shifts in the transverse direction.

    For locks of the holding type, when voltage is applied, the resulting magnetic field in the anchor-core circuit keeps the sash from opening.


    The principle of operation of the holding electromagnetic lock

    For shear-type devices, the armature has holes, and the core has protrusions for these holes. When voltage is applied, the armature is brought to the core and is attracted to it. In this case, the protrusions of the magnetic circuit enter the corresponding grooves of the armature. In this case, the holding force is characterized by the force that must be applied to move the anchor, and the design features of the protrusions and holes.

    Sliding locks are installed using a tie-in in the end of the leaf and, thanks to this, this type allows you to install a secret magnetic deadbolt on the front door.
